Sublette Woman Crashes into Snow Bank

KSCB News - April 2, 2009 12:00 am

A Sublette woman received possible injuries yesterday after a crash 3.5 miles west of Satanta in Haskell County. The wreck occurred at about 8:23 yesterday morning. Forty-two year old Michelle Lumley of Sublette was driving a 2006 GMC Yukon west on Highway 56. The vehicle drifted off the road and into a culvert where the vehicle crashed into a snow bank. Lumley was taken to Satanta District Hospital with a possible injury.
